Apple's voice assistant is undergoing a fundamental architectural shift from a command-based system to a generative AI-powered agent. While users currently experience a 'competency gap,' the transition to the new Siri promises a sudden, non-linear leap in capability as Apple Intelligence features reach full scale.
Apple has officially unveiled its next-generation MacBook Air and MacBook Pro lineups, powered by the new M5 chip architecture. These devices are specifically engineered to accelerate intensive AI and machine learning workloads, marking a significant step in Apple's hardware roadmap.
Apple is intensifying its focus on AI-driven hardware, developing smart glasses, a wearable pendant, and AirPods equipped with cameras. These devices aim to leverage multimodal AI to provide real-time environmental awareness and personal assistance.
